Studi Pertambahan Beban Transformator Daya Pada Gardu Induk Parit Baru PT. PLN (Persero) Cabang Pontianak
ABSTRACT: The need
for electricity Pontianak
continued to rise
every year. The
fact requires the
development and good planning in electric power systems. One of the components
in the power system needs to be improved is the power transformer.
This is needed
because the power
transformer plays an
important role in
distributing electricity to consumers. Based on peak load feeders
data from PT. PLN (Persero) Parit Baru
substation Branch Pontianak, it has described the rapid development of load
capacity. This resulted in the need for further studies to predict the load at
the substation. Increasing the capacity of the power transformer i n the
substation Parit Baru can be done by calculating the peak load prediction for
the current and future. Studies needed to increase the peak load
is used to
calculate the approximate
capacity of power
transformer in the
substation by using
an exponential regression
function which has the
smallest standard error as compared with the
linear regression function. Based on the results of the approximate
calculation of the load and by SPLN17A / 79, the peak load in 2016 amounted to
30.904 MVA happened already past
capacity power transformer substation in Parit Baru and that should be
anticipated with the correct solution. Results to be achieved in 2016 is to
increase the capacity of power transformer in the Parit Baru substation.
